Things could not have gone worse for the Dallas Stars during Tuesday’s NHL Western Conference Finals Game 3. Seventy-one seconds into the game, Jonathan Marchessault scored a goal for the Vegas Golden Knights. Forty-two seconds after that, Stars captain Jamie Benn was ejected from the game for cross-checking Mark Stone. Vegas scored on that power play. William Carrier made it 3-0 for Vegas at 7:10 of the first period. With that, Jake Oettinger’s night in the Dallas net ended. Dallas never got on the board. The game ended 4-0. That result put Vegas one game away from the 2023 Stanley Cup Finals.

The Golden Knights play Game 4 of the 2023 NHL Western Conference Finals tonight, Thursday, May 25, in Dallas. The 2023 NHL playoff series between the Golden Knights and the Stars is a rematch of the 2020 Western Conference Finals, which the Stars won in five games.

Vegas Golden Knights betting breakdown

The Vegas Golden Knights never allowed the Dallas Stars to set the tone in Game 3 of the NHL Western Conference Finals. With the team jumping to an early lead, Vegas put Dallas on their heels and kept them there for the entire game. Expect Vegas to be prepared for a fast and physical start from the Stars in Game 4, and if Game 3 was any indication, the Golden Knights will play disciplined and focused hockey. Their goal is one more win and a trip to the 2023 Stanley Cup Finals.

Jonathan Marchessault has two goals and three points in the 2023 NHL Western Conference Finals. He has nine points (five goals, four assists) in his past five games.

Adin Hill has been outstanding in net for Vegas in this series. His save percentage in his three starts against Dallas: .917, .929, and 1.00. He had 34 saves in his first career playoff shutout in Game 3.

Dallas Stars betting breakdown

Three things happened in the first period of Game 3 of the NHL Western Conference Finals. First, Dallas Stars captain Jamie Benn was given a game misconduct for a cross-check. Second, goaltender Jake Oettinger was pulled after giving up three goals. And third, forward Evgenii Dadonov left the ice with an injury and would not return. Later, fans littered the ice with debris, Max Domi picked up a 10-minute misconduct, and the Stars left the ice with a 4-0 loss. The Stars look to avoid being swept from the Western Conference Finals in front of a home crowd tonight.

“Yeah, I’m not sure you could script much worse,” Stars coach Peter DeBoer said after the Game 3 loss.

Jason Robertson and Roope Hintz each have three points in this series. If they cannot score, the Stars need other players on the team to pitch in. Only eight players on the Stars have a point in this series, and two of those players are Benn and, Dadonov. The Stars will be without Benn after the NHL suspended him for two games and Dadonov is not likely to play in Game 4 because of a lower-body injury.

Oettinger has not played well this series. His save percentage is just .812. He’s likely to get the start in Game 4, but don’t expect the coaching staff to give him much time in net if he falters early.
